		<title>Tiger Prawns in Garlic Ginger Soy Sauce</title>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2>Triggers your sense of taste, gingerly</h2>
<h3>Ingredients</h3>
<div class="cooked-recipe-ingredients">
<div itemprop="recipeIngredient" class="cooked-single-ingredient cooked-ingredient cooked-ing-no-checkbox"><span class="cooked-ing-amount" data-decimal="1">1</span> <span class="cooked-ing-measurement">tbsp</span> <span class="cooked-ing-name">olive oil</span></div>
<div itemprop="recipeIngredient" class="cooked-single-ingredient cooked-ingredient cooked-ing-no-checkbox"><span class="cooked-ing-amount" data-decimal="2">2</span> <span class="cooked-ing-measurement">tbsp</span> <span class="cooked-ing-name">ginger **minced</span></div>
<div itemprop="recipeIngredient" class="cooked-single-ingredient cooked-ingredient cooked-ing-no-checkbox"><span class="cooked-ing-amount" data-decimal="1">1</span> <span class="cooked-ing-measurement">tbsp</span> <span class="cooked-ing-name">garlic **minced</span></div>
<div itemprop="recipeIngredient" class="cooked-single-ingredient cooked-ingredient cooked-ing-no-checkbox"><span class="cooked-ing-amount" data-decimal="15">15</span> <span class="cooked-ing-measurement"></span> <span class="cooked-ing-name">pcs tiger prawn large</span></div>
<div itemprop="recipeIngredient" class="cooked-single-ingredient cooked-ingredient cooked-ing-no-checkbox"><span class="cooked-ing-amount" data-decimal="1">1</span> <span class="cooked-ing-measurement">tbsp</span> <span class="cooked-ing-name">Chinese cooking wine</span></div>
<div itemprop="recipeIngredient" class="cooked-single-ingredient cooked-ingredient cooked-ing-no-checkbox"><span class="cooked-ing-amount" data-decimal="4">4</span> <span class="cooked-ing-measurement">tbsp</span> <span class="cooked-ing-name">soy sauce</span></div>
<div itemprop="recipeIngredient" class="cooked-single-ingredient cooked-ingredient cooked-ing-no-checkbox"><span class="cooked-ing-amount" data-decimal="0.5">&#189;</span> <span class="cooked-ing-measurement">tbsp</span> <span class="cooked-ing-name">sugar</span></div>
<div itemprop="recipeIngredient" class="cooked-single-ingredient cooked-ingredient cooked-ing-no-checkbox"><span class="cooked-ing-amount" data-decimal="1">1</span> <span class="cooked-ing-measurement">tsp</span> <span class="cooked-ing-name">ground black pepper</span></div>
<div itemprop="recipeIngredient" class="cooked-single-ingredient cooked-ingredient cooked-ing-no-checkbox"><span class="cooked-ing-amount" data-decimal="2">2</span> <span class="cooked-ing-measurement">tbsp</span> <span class="cooked-ing-name">water</span></div>
<div itemprop="recipeIngredient" class="cooked-single-ingredient cooked-ingredient cooked-ing-no-checkbox"><span class="cooked-ing-amount" data-decimal="2">2</span> <span class="cooked-ing-measurement">tbsp</span> <span class="cooked-ing-name">cilantro</span></div>
</div>
<h3>Directions</h3>
<div class="cooked-recipe-directions">
<div class="cooked-single-direction cooked-direction" data-step="Step 1">
<div class="cooked-dir-content">
<p>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add ginger and garlic and cook for 30 seconds until fragrant. Add tiger prawns and stir to coat with oil. Continue to cook for 1-2 minutes, stirring constantly to ensure even cooking on all sides.</p>
</div>
</div>
<div class="cooked-single-direction cooked-direction" data-step="Step 2">
<div class="cooked-dir-content">
<p>Stir in cooking wine and continue to stir for 15 seconds. Stir in soy sauce and reduce heat to medium. Cook for 1 minute, stirring occasionally.</p>
</div>
</div>
<div class="cooked-single-direction cooked-direction" data-step="Step 3">
<div class="cooked-dir-content">
<p>Stir in sugar, pepper (optional) and water. Turn heat to high, cover and cook for 2 minutes.</p>
</div>
</div>
<div class="cooked-single-direction cooked-direction" data-step="Step 4">
<div class="cooked-dir-content">
<p>Turn heat down to low, give the prawns a final stir, ensuring that the sauce is coating the prawns completely.</p>
</div>
</div>
<div class="cooked-single-direction cooked-direction" data-step="Step 5">
<div class="cooked-dir-content">
<p>Serve with some cilantro on top.</p>
</div>
</div>
</div>

		<title>Stir Fry Crabs with Ginger and Scallions</title>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2>Sure to take a pinch of your tastebuds</h2>
<h3>Ingredients</h3>
<div class="cooked-recipe-ingredients"></div>
<h3>Directions</h3>
<div class="cooked-recipe-directions">
<div class="cooked-single-direction cooked-direction" data-step="Step 1">
<div class="cooked-dir-content">
<p>Wash the crab, pull off the top shell, put its shell aside, and pull off the gills to discard. Chop the body into 4 or the desired number of pieces.</p>
</div>
</div>
<div class="cooked-single-direction cooked-direction" data-step="Step 2">
<div class="cooked-dir-content">
<p>Heat wok on high heat and add oil. Add in ginger slices and half of the scallions. Stir fry until fragrant.</p>
</div>
</div>
<div class="cooked-single-direction cooked-direction" data-step="Step 3">
<div class="cooked-dir-content">
<p>Place the crab pieces into the wok, including the top shell.Stir fry over high heat for 2 to 3 minutes, exposing all sides of the crab to heat until brown.</p>
</div>
</div>
<div class="cooked-single-direction cooked-direction" data-step="Step 4">
<div class="cooked-dir-content">
<p>Pour in the rice wine and sugar. Give it a stir then cover the wok.</p>
</div>
</div>
<div class="cooked-single-direction cooked-direction" data-step="Step 5">
<div class="cooked-dir-content">
<p>Turn the heat down to medium and cook for 5 minutes, checking frequently. If it becomes dry in the wok, add a small amount of water (1/4 cup at most). The point here is to have enough liquid in the wok to keep the crab meat moist at the end but with little to no sauce. With 2 minutes left to go,add the rest of the scallions, stir once and cover.</p>
</div>
</div>
<div class="cooked-single-direction cooked-direction" data-step="Step 6">
<div class="cooked-dir-content">
<p>To check if the crab is cooked through, use a fork to pierce its fleshy parts. If the crab meat separates easily, it is done. Take out immediately and serve hot.</p>
</div>
</div>
</div>
